Relations between subjective spatialisation, geometrical parameters and acoustical criteria in concert halls

TLDR
In this paper, the relationship between geometrical parameters, acoustical criteria and subjecive characteristics of sound spatialisation in concert halls was investigated using multiple correspondence analysis.
